我在用户 crontab 中找到了以下条目:
*/5 * * * * ~/bin/php /path/to/phpscript &> /path/to/logfile
这里的(&)是什么意思&
?还有后台运行的意思吗?这在 cronjob 中有意义吗?
答案1
感谢@Stephen Kitt。找到了答案shell 的控制和重定向运算符是什么?:
command &> out.txt
命令的标准错误和标准输出都会保存在out.txt中,覆盖其内容,如果不存在则创建它。
我在用户 crontab 中找到了以下条目:
*/5 * * * * ~/bin/php /path/to/phpscript &> /path/to/logfile
这里的(&)是什么意思&
?还有后台运行的意思吗?这在 cronjob 中有意义吗?
感谢@Stephen Kitt。找到了答案shell 的控制和重定向运算符是什么?:
command &> out.txt
命令的标准错误和标准输出都会保存在out.txt中,覆盖其内容,如果不存在则创建它。